#fedc30 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fedc30 is composed of 99.6% red, 86.3%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.4% magenta, 81.1%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 50.1 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 59.2%. #fedc30 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ff60 with #fdb900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#fedc30 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fedc30 has RGB values of R:254, G:220,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.81, K:0. Its decimal value is 16702512.

Hex triplet fedc30 #fedc30
RGB Decimal 254, 220, 48 rgb(254,220,48)
RGB Percent 99.6, 86.3, 18.8 rgb(99.6%,86.3%,18.8%)
CMYK 0, 13, 81, 0
HSL 50.1°, 99, 59.2 hsl(50.1,99%,59.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 50.1°, 81.1, 99.6
Web Safe ffcc33 #ffcc33
CIE-LAB 88.196, -4.13, 80.524
XYZ 67.001, 72.473, 13.256
xyY 0.439, 0.475, 72.473
CIE-LCH 88.196, 80.63, 92.936
CIE-LUV 88.196, 30.547, 89.437
Hunter-Lab 85.131, -8.495, 50.36
Binary 11111110, 11011100, 00110000

Shades and Tints of #fedc30

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080600 is the darkest color, while #fffdf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fedc30

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9c90 is the less saturated color, while #fedc30 is the most saturated one.
